Grey Reef Winter?


Fishing reports were very strong yesterday and there were a few very large rainbows who hesitated momentarily, in the grasp of the lucky Grey Ref angler, for some photos. Conditions have been nothing short of spectacular. Yesterday was mostly calm and 60* with clear water and willing fish. As I look out the window this AM it has finally started to snow at 7AM. Big wet flakes and we will take all that we can get. Although the NOAA snowpack report still lists our critical drainages at 85-95% it has been a bit unnerving to have such nice conditions for a month.

We have had quite a few guide trips out this week and plenty of guests enjoying the cottages. While it has been nice for business we would really rather get blitzed with snow and have the comfort of solid water conditions…we won’t complain about shoveling we promise!
